Bruce Willis can be seen now in “RED 2,” the sequel to the surprise 2010 hit about a group of retired special agents who are called back into action on a very important mission that will also save their lives.

Speaking of the film at a New York City screening, the actor joked about getting to kiss other women than his wife, saying writers were thinking of having him make out with a man as well, Christian Post reports.

“They were trying to get me to kiss John Malkovich in this film because he is in a dress, but I said no because I wasn't feeling it,” Willis said.

As for kissing women, Bruce explained why he got no trouble at home with the missus.

“I will say, ‘Look honey, it's right here in the script. It says, Now Bruce kisses Mary-Louise Parker. Now Bruce kisses Catherine Zeta-Jones’,” he joked.

Besides Willis and Malkovich, “RED 2” stars Helen Mirren (whom Bruce doesn’t kiss), Mary-Louise Parker, Anthony Hopkins, Catherine Zeta-Jones, and Neal McDonough.
